What You’re Likely Seeing
A "bumble bee looking bug" is usually a harmless mimic rather than a true bumble bee. Common lookalikes include carpenter bees, bee flies, hoverflies, and some wasps. These insects copy bee patterns for protection but differ in body shape, flight behavior, and nesting habits. True bumble bees are stout, densely hairy, and slow-flying, while mimics are often sleeker and more agile. Correct ID helps reduce unnecessary concern and supports pollinator-friendly practices around homes and gardens.
Key Groups That Resemble Bumble Bees
Carpenter Bees
Carpenter bees (Xylocopa spp.) closely resemble bumble bees but have a shiny, mostly hairless abdomen. They are strong fliers and often seen hovering near wood surfaces, where females excavate tunnels. Males may appear aggressive but lack a stinger. Unlike bumble bees, which nest in soil or abandoned rodent burrows, carpenter bees prefer weathered wood for nesting. Recognizing hairless vs. hairy abdomens aids quick field identification.
Bee Flies
Bee flies (Bombyliidae) are stout, fuzzy flies with long proboscises and boldly patterned wings. They mimic bumble bees to visit flowers for nectar and to lay eggs near solitary bee nests. Bee flies do not pollinate efficiently like bees but are harmless to humans. Their hovering flight and rounded bodies can cause brief confusion. Pupation occurs in soil, where larvae parasitise host pupae.
Hoverflies and Syrphid Flies
Hoverflies (Syrphidae) are the most frequent bee mimics in gardens. They have only one pair of functional wings and large eyes, yet exhibit bright bands of yellow and black. Many species perform hovering flights while feeding. They do not sting and play a role in controlling aphids. Accurate separation from bumble bees relies on wing count, body proportions, and behavior.
Some Wasps and Hornets
Certain wasps, such as paper wasps and yellowjackets, share black-and-yellow striping but are less hairy and more slender than bumble bees. They are typically more aggressive around food and nests and can sting multiple times. Paper wasps hang open-cell nests from eaves; yellowjackets often nest in ground cavities. Observing nest location and body hair helps avoid misidentification.
How to Tell a True Bumble Bee Apart
Reliable field ID combines size, hairiness, flight pattern, and nesting clues. Bumble bees are generally larger and hairier, with robust thorax and abdomen, producing a fuzzy appearance. They buzz loudly during flower visits, a trait called buzz pollination. Nests hold dozens to a few hundred individuals, often in ground burrows or insulated cavities. By noting these details, observers can reduce confusion with lookalikes.
Practical Identification Checklist
Use the following structured comparison to distinguish bumble bees from close mimics:
| Attribute | Verified Detail | Source Type |
|---|---|---|
| Body Hair Density | Bumble bees appear very hairy; carpenter bees and many wasps are sleeker | Field guides, entomology references |
| Wing Count | Bumble bees have two pairs of wings; hoverflies have one pair | Insect anatomy references |
| Nest Location | Bumble bees often nest in soil or sheltered cavities; carpenter bees in wood; wasps in sheltered structures or ground | Behavioral studies, extension resources |
| Stinging Behavior | Bumble bees can sting but usually avoid; wasps and hornets may be more aggressive | Entomology texts, pest management advisories |
| Flight Pattern | Bumble bees typically move steadily; bee flies hover; wasps may be rapid and jerky | Field observation summaries |
Behavior, Ecology, and Seasonal Patterns
Bumble bees are active in cooler temperatures and early season blooms, making them important early-spring pollinators. Colonies peak in late summer and decline in cool weather. Carpenter bees bore into unfinished wood, sometimes causing cosmetic damage but rarely structural harm. Bee flies emerge in spring to parasitize solitary bee larvae. Hoverflies thrive in gardens and can appear in multiple generations per year. Understanding seasonal timing complements visual ID and explains why certain mimics appear at particular times.
Safety, Control, and Coexistence
Most "bumble bee looking bug" encounters involve harmless species that do not require treatment. Avoid disturbing any nest, and consult a local extension professional for confirmation before considering control. Exclusion and habitat modification, such as sealing wood gaps or securing waste, reduce unwanted nesting. Tolerating non-threatening mimics supports garden biodiversity. When necessary, targeted, least-toxic methods applied by licensed professionals minimize risk to pollinators and people.
